Microsoft, US Lab Utilize AI to Expedite Discovery of Battery Materials With 70% Less Lithium
Microsoft has collaborated with the Pacific Northwest National Laboratory (PNNL) in Richland, Washington, to leverage artificial intelligence (AI) for the swift identification of a potential battery material that could reduce lithium requirements by 70%, the company announced on Tuesday. (via COVID-Causing Virus in Air Detected with High-Tech Bubbles | PNNL)
A team of scientists at the Department of Energy’s Pacific Northwest National Laboratory created a new kind of micelle, one that is stamped on the surface with copies of an imprinted particle for SARS-CoV-2.
The team filled micelles with a salt capable of creating an electronic signal but that is quiescent when packed inside a micelle. When a viral particle interacts with one of the imprinted receptors on the surface, the micelle pops open, spilling the salt and sending out an electronic signal instantly.

The team estimates that the technology can pluck one viral particle out of billions of other particles. The detector is so sensitive that the team had a challenging time identifying the lower limit. The team used both inactivated SARS-CoV-2 viral particles and the virus’s spike protein in its tests.
While the technology detects the virus within a millisecond, the device takes an additional minute to run quality-control software to confirm the signal and prevent false alarms.
